The Twelfth Peak: Santiago Peak

Trailhead:

Maple Springs Road

Type of Hike:

Day hike

Trail Conditions:

Trail in good condition

ROAD:

Road rough but passable

Bugs:

Bugs were an annoyance

Snow:

Snow free

This hike almost didn't happen this year. But after hearing from friends who bagged this peak either by Cadillac-Joplin or by Maple Springs Road I decided to try the Maple Springs Road. I didn't start at the trailhead but instead drove in by about five miles thus making my hike a 13.2 round trip hike instead of the full 20 mile round trip hike. The weather was good. There were however bugs which were an annoyance although they weren't present for the entire route. The trail was essentially a fire road. I was the only hiker on the trail. Everyone else on the trail were either bicyclists, motorcyclists or cars or trucks or SUVs. But the hike itself was excellent. The weather was just right and other than the bugs and the dust from the vehicles it was a good experience.  This hike was done in the afternoon. I drove in at around 11:15am and got to the place where I had decided to park my vehicle at around 11:40am and there I had lunch. I then started hiking at 12:05pm and reached the summit at 2:33 pm. I took pictures and then headed out to the lookout ridge and chatted with a few people who had driven up the road I just hiked. I started hiking back at 3:18pm and reached my car at around 5:35pm. I then loaded up and then got in and drove back to the trailhead. The sun was just setting when I  got back to the trailhead in my vehicle. And with that the SoCal Six-Pack of Peaks 2019 ended on a high note that I had gotten all 12 peaks in the lineup.
